RTSP not working (401 unauthorized)

Hi,

I’m running 3 Eufy 2K Indoor cameras (T8410) on firmware version 2.1.5.1 . Through the app everything is working but the RTSP streaming stopped working and returns 401 unauthorized…
If I disable authentication it works but on basic or digest returns the error above. It was working before, and of course I also tried reconfiguring the camera but no luck there. Is this happening to anyone else?

Authentication problem (Server returned 401 Unauthorized) on the RTSP stream with basic auth.
The problem appeared with the update of the camera firmware in 2.1.5.1.

works only with Authentication disabled

new version (2.1.6.4) is avalible where the Digest/Basic works again

A few days ago the new app update removed the RTSP connection error but I was still left with a blank screen after.

Yesterday I got the version 2.1.6.4 update on my cameras and RTSP is finally working again.
